Saftey Helpful hints for Roller Coasters

If you wish to stay safe on a roller coaster there are certain rules you have to have to follow. One of the most important ones is to obey the rules posted by the ride. If there are weight, height and age limitations stick to them. Always listen to what the ride operator tells you. Make sure the ride operator is legit by checking his ID badge. Never wave your arms around. Keep your hands, arms and legs inside the ride. Seat belts and shoulder harnesses or any other safety equipment provided has to be worn. Don't try and exit the ride unless it really is completely stopped.

If your kids will be riding the roller coaster ride there are certain things you have to have to accomplish too. Make sure they are monitored at all times on the ride. Wathc the operator and make certain they are actually paying attention to what the ride is doing. Talk with your child before he goes on any rdes and explain safety rules such as keeping ther hands, arms and feet inside and obeying the operator.

Don't hesitate to notify an official of the park or fair if you observe a ride that is unsafe or an operator that is not following the guidelines.

Responsibility

Liability will be distinct in each case. Liability will be determined by the circumstances of the accident at the amusement park.

Accidents are typically caused by one of the following:

  • Rider behavior (i.e., unbuckling your seatbelt on a ride)
  • Operator behavior
  • Mechanical failure
  • Design limitation

Claims

When claims are lodged against theme parks they are typically for the following things. The amusement park ride was not kept in really good condition or was not inspected regularly. Proper instructions or warnings aren't supplied to the riders by the operators. The ride isn't operated properly and an injury is the result. The ride is designed in such a way that that normal operation because an injusry risk. Even when sidewalks and publics areas aren't kept safe it can cause incidents.

Just What Are the most frequent injuries:

  • Neck injuries;
  • Back injuries;
  • Head and brain injuries;
  • Heart attack; and
  • Fractures.

Reports indicate approximately half of all ride-related injuries take place to kids under the age of 13. A frequent reason behind incidents at theme parks is when parents allow their kids to go on rides that aren't appropriate for their size. If they child does not meet the height requirements they really should never be allowed on the ride.

Water rides pose an additional risk because the height requirements aren't regulated at the federal level.

As a general rule, be conservative whenever you are unsure if a ride is safe.
